Roussanne
Sommeliers and customer voices combined.
Lush yet bright, Zerba Cellars Roussanne opens with layered aromas of beeswax, toasted honeycomb, and ripe orchard fruits, unfolding into juicy pear, white peach, and honeydew. Citrus zest and chamomile tea lend freshness to the full-bodied palate, while a subtle herbal note keeps the wine dynamic and intriguing. Its rich texture and lingering finish make it a captivating white wine with serious presence. Pair this Roussanne with roasted chicken glazed in citrus and honey, creamy seafood pasta, or a fragrant Moroccan tagine with apricots and almonds. It also complements mild cheeses like Comté or Brie, offering a beautiful balance of weight and acidity. A wine to savor, whether on its own or alongside an elegant meal.
